Jurnal Penelitian dan Pengukuran Psikoogi (JPPP) is an open access journal in psychology published by The Faculty of Psychology Universitas Negeri Jakarta (UNJ). JPPP is a bi-annual peer reviewed journal that publishes original and meaningful contributions to the field of psychology in Indonesia. The journal aims for experimental, theoretical, measurement development and theoretical review articles in all areas of psychology. In particular, we expected to received article with advances statistical analysis in measurement, psychometric, and modelling study in psychology.

Abstract

Burnout has various impacts in various work professions, especially teachers, interventions carried out to solve stress problems that lead to burnout are so rare. The research was conducted to find out whether mindfulness training had an impact on reducing burnout symptoms in inclusive teachers at PKBM Lentera Fajar Indonesia. The samples Paired T-Test analysis test showed that the post-test average score of the burnout questionnaire with mindfulness training in inclusive teacher was significantly smaller than the pre-test average score.used is a one-group pre-test and post-test design. This study uses an adapted burnout measurement tool. The t-test in the form of a paired sample t-test obtained a significance value of 0.001<0.005. This means, the burnout level before and after being given mindfulness training is not the same. Thus, it can be stated that there is a significant difference between before being given training and after being given mindfulness training, it can be concluded that mindfulness training for burnout in inclusive teachers can reduce the level of burnout in participants.

Abstract

Good character is a congruence of thought, feelings and behaviors that are in accordance with principles of morality. Since 2016 Indonesian education system attempts to develop good character in students using principles for encouraging character education (PPK, Penguatan Pendidikan Karakter). The principles of PPK are based on Pancasila, Indonesia national ideology. These five principles are religiosity, nationalism, independence, cooperation, and integrity. Currently, there are no instrument for measuring good character in accordance with the principle of PPK. This study aims to develop a reliable and valid measuring tool for good character that can be used for measuring good character in Indonesian high school students. In the development of this measurement, this study tests the reliability with discriminatory item analysis using SPSS v.21. Construct validity was measured using confirmatory factor analysis with JASP emulation MPlus, from which group norm was formed with average of 10 and standard deviation of 3. The subjects of this study are 728 Indonesian high school students. The result of this study show that the instrument can be deemed reliable with Cronbach alpha of 0.892. This instrument also shows model fit p-value of 0.000, SRMRS of 0.078 and GFI of 0.957, which can be interpreted as a reliable in term of measurement.

Abstract

Research on logical reasoning began to be carried out in Indonesia, it is necessary to conduct an evaluation of the psychometric characteristics possessed by logical reasoning measurement tools made by researchers. Logical reasoning measurement tools made by researchers need to be re-evaluated considering there are weaknesses in terms of using a relatively small number of subjects, so that it can affect the standardization of logical reasoning measuring devices. This study aims to obtain an overview of item difficulty index, item discrimination index, effectiveness of the distractors, validity, reliability, and error measurement from the logical reasoning measurement tool. Respondents in this study amounted to 7.730 students, consisting of 3.897 men and 3.833 women with an age range of 15-19 years. The research data were analyzed with the help of Microsoft Excel 2007, SPSS version 22.00, and ITEMAN version 3.6. The results of this study indicate that the item difficulty index moves from 0.35 to 0.80 which belongs to the easy and medium category. This study also shows that the item discrimination index moves from 0.10 to 0.71 with four items rejected and need to be aborted. This study also shows that the effectiveness of the distractors contained in each item in the logical reasoning measure is in the effective category. This study also shows that each item in the logical reasoning measure is considered valid in terms of factorial validity through exploratory factor analysis (EFA) procedures. This study also shows that the measurement of logical reasoning is relatively reliable with a Cronbach Alpha coefficient of 0.906. This study also shows that the measurement error obtained in this study is ± 3.92 of the total score obtained using a logical reasoning measure with a confidence level of 95%, with the actual score estimate obtained by respondents moving from 12.08 to 19.92, if the scores obtained by respondents sixteen.

Abstract

College students have higher academic requirements and responsibilities compared to previous education levels. Being academically motivated is very important so that success at college can be achieved. However, remote learning due to COVID-19 pandemic rises new challenges for college students in maintaining their academic motivation level. Previous research has shown that self-regulated learning (SRL) and perceived social support have a significant positive relationship with academic motivation. This study aims to determine the effect of self-regulated online learning (SROL) which is SRL in an online learning environment, as well as perceived social support on the academic motivation of college students who participated in remote learning, either fully online or blended learning between online and offline. A total of 162 undergraduate and postgraduate students were involved in this study. Academic motivation is measured through the Academic Motivation Scale (AMS); SROL is measured through the Self-Regulated Online Learning (SROL) scale; and perceived social support is measured through the Multidimensional Scale of Perceived Social Support (MSPSS). The results of multiple linear regression analysis indicate that SROL and perceived social support together have a positive and significant effect of 35.9% on academic motivation. Furthermore, SROL was found to make a greater contribution to the academic motivation of college students participating in remote learning compared to perceived social support.

Abstract

Technological developments make it easier for humans to network widely through social media such as Instagram. Active Instagram users in Indonesia are dominated by teenagers. The existence of social media allows cyberbullying to occur, which is an act of bullying via the internet that can trigger victims to blame themselves. The purpose of this study was to determine the effect of cyberbullying on adolescents who experience self-blaming via Instagram. The method used in this study is quantitative with a non-experimental regression approach. The data collection technique was carried out using an instrument in the form of a Likert scale, while the data collection method was through a questionnaire filled out via the Google form. Participants in this study were young Instagram users aged 18-22 years. Based on the results of the simple regression test that has been carried out by researchers, it can be concluded that cyberbullying has a significant effect on self-blaming. After conducting this research, it is hoped that further researchers can intervene through education on social media such as distributing e-flyers related to cyberbullying behavior so that they can suppress cyberbullying actions that occur on social media.

Abstract

Sebagai bagian penting dari industri dan organisasi, terdapat dua jenis karyawan yakni karyawan tetap dan kontrak. Karyawan tetap memiliki kelebihan dari karyawan kontrak misalnya dalam hal kemampuan, komitmen, kepuasan kerja, dan perilaku inovatif yang lebih tinggi. Di satu sisi, banyak karyawan kontrak di Indonesia menuntut dijadikan karyawan tetap. Akan tetapi, pada kenyataannya, instansi di Indonesia memiliki kesulitan untuk mengangkat karyawan kontraknya menjadi karyawan tetap. Pertimbangan akan komitmen serta biaya yang harus dikeluarkan, serta keraguan instansi akan kesiapan bekerja dari para karyawan kontraknya menjadi masalah dalam hal ini. Perlu adanya seleksi tepat untuk mengukur kesiapan bekerja karyawannya agar dapat memprediksi kemampuan seseorang dalam bekerja. Untuk itu, penelitian ini bertujuan mengembangkan alat ukur work readiness yang sesuai dengan Indonesia. Dengan menggunakan metode kuantitatif, pengembangan alat ukur ini terdapat lima tahap, yaitu konseptualisasi, konstruksi, uji coba, analisis item, dan revisi alat ukur. Partisipan yang terlibat sebanyak 320 karyawan kontrak, sehingga dihasilkan alat ukur Work Readiness 24 Item. Hasil koefisien α Work Readiness Scale dari 24 item adalah sebesar 0.864, sedangkan analisis goodness of fit dari alat ukur ini ialah CFI 0.95, RMSEA 0.06, IFI 0.95, dan NFI 0.90. Oleh karena itu dapat disimpulkan bahwa alat ukur ini secara keseluruhan dinilai reliabel dan valid.

Abstract

Digital literacy is becoming increasingly important in the current era of digitalization, but the level of digital literacy in Indonesia is still low. This research aims to develop and test the psychometric properties of the LD-UAJ Digital Literacy Test as a measure of students' digital literacy abilities. The LD-UAJ test is designed to measure the minimum proficiency in digital technology before entering the workforce. It is an achievement test consisting of 30 multiple-choice questions that measure five dimensions of digital literacy: information and data literacy, communication and collaboration, digital competence, security, and problem-solving. The development of the LD-UAJ digital literacy test involved two data collection phases with 97 active undergraduate students. Through the convenience sampling technique, 46 participants were involved in the pilot test, and 51 in the field test. In this study, item analysis, validity, and reliability methods were used to evaluate the psychometric properties of the LD-UAJ test. The analysis results show that the LD-UAJ test has good validity in terms of content validity, particularly through expert opinions, and face validity with the participants. The reliability results indicate that the LD-UAJ test is reliable with an omega coefficient of 0.82. Further research is needed to validate the criterion-related validity as the criteria used during the development did not show a strong relationship with digital literacy. This study also highlights the existing barriers in the development of the LD-UAJ test, such as time limitations, low student interest and participation, and difficulties in obtaining a sufficiently large sample. However, the LD-UAJ test is expected to be a useful measuring tool in evaluating students' level of digital literacy and can help recommend appropriate training to enhance their digital literacy understanding. Abstract

The emergence of the Covid 19 Pandemic in March 2020 in Indonesia meant that education implementation regulations needed adjustments to protect education implementers from this infectious virus. The government has determined Distance Learning (PJJ) as the new learning regulation and is most likely to be implemented. Transforming learning activities from face-to-face to PJJ should require careful preparation and adequate training. However, due to its emergency nature and not much time available, preparations were not carried out as planned. The urgent transition to online teaching as a response to the COVID 19 pandemic is referred to as emergency remote teaching (ERT). Emergency Remote Teaching is a distance teaching method applied by educational institutions in crisis situations because face-to-face learning is not possible. The transition from face-to-face learning to ERT has caused a number of new problems to emerge in the world of education. With several obstacles and problems found, learning during the ERT period recorded at least a third of the school year lost. This situation could potentially lead to a decline in academic knowledge and skills which could cause learning loss. Learning loss will continue to impact and accumulate even until students return to face-to-face learning. School closures due to the Covid-19 pandemic and increasing the risk of learning loss can also have a significant impact on the risk of decreasing happiness
